We kayaked to the nearby estuary (about a 15 minute kayak trip) and watched the sunset. We also snorkeled there in the morning. You can see dolphins in the morning. At night there was luminescent plankton and the movement of your limbs sparkled under water. We could hear the dolphins clicking as well.

A few things to be aware of... as stated in many of the reviews, you need to make sure you bring paper towels, toilet paper, trash bags, etc (this really should be pointed out by the owner). Also, the condo is on the edge of the complex and the adjacent beach and desert area is public. There were no problems with loud crowds (as noted in one of the reviews) but we did have some things stolen off the porch on our last night (fishing pole, tackle box, etc).
